Nintendo
157 products
Showing 97 - 144 of 157 products
Showing 97 - 144 of 157 products
Display
View
Nintendo
SWI the Legend of Zelda Link's Awakening Game
Sale price£61.00 GBP
In stock
BUY MORE SAVE MORE!
New
Nintendo
SWI The Legend of Zelda: Echoes of Wisdom Game
Sale price£54.95 GBP
In stock
BUY MORE SAVE MORE!
Filters (0)












